This is a mobile HVAC role covering a premium commercial portfolio inside the M25. You will work on a planned route with structured call management. The role suits an engineer who enjoys fault finding, service quality, and technical variety.

Responsibilities

  • Planned servicing and maintenance of HVAC equipment
  • Reactive fault finding and breakdown response
  • Working on VRV and VRF systems, splits, and packaged units
  • Supporting basic chiller and AHU checks depending on site setup
  • Fault finding on controls, sensors, and basic BMS interfaces
  • Completing minor repairs, part changes, and first line install support
  • Completing service reports and compliance paperwork
  • Using a CAFM system to update tasks and close jobs accurately
  • Liaising with clients and site contacts professionally

What We're Looking For

  • F Gas qualification
  • NVQ Level 2 in Air Conditioning, Refrigeration, or HVAC
  • Commercial maintenance experience
  • Strong fault finding skills and clean reporting
  • Full UK driving licence

Benefits

  • Β£55,000 salary
  • Monday to Friday schedule
  • 25 to 27 days annual leave plus bank holidays
  • Good pension scheme
  • Company van and fuel card
  • Overtime available
  • Training budget and progression pathway
